I S <br /> Quik Stop Market No 121 <br /> CCI Project No 12118-2 <br /> Page 2 <br /> series drilling rig The well was installed by first cutting a 10-inch diameter hole through the <br /> sidewalk,then hand auguring a 6-inch diameter hole to 5 feet Upon completion of the hand <br /> auguring, the MD drill rig was positioned over the augered hole and then a 2 5-inch outside <br /> diameter (O D ) Enviro-Core casing was pushed to 30 feet The 2 5-inch Enviro-Core casing was <br /> then pulled out of the hole, a disposable tip was added to the bottom of the casing, and the casing <br /> was then pushed back to the bottom of the hole The pre-packed well consisted of fifteen feet of <br /> 314" diameter screen within a 1 25" diameter screen Between the inner wall of the 125" <br /> diameter screen and the outer wall of the 3/4" diameter screen is the filter pac, which consists of <br /> 2112 Lone Star sand PVC pre-pack collars with stainless steel hose clamps secure both the inner <br /> and outer ends of the screened interval, which holds the pre-packed sand in place Three quarter <br /> inch diameter solid PVC pipe extends from the top of the screen interval to the surface As the <br /> sand was added, the 2 5-inch core-barrel was removed from the hole The sand interval was <br /> raised to approximately 2 feet above the top of the screen interval, and approximately 1 foot of <br /> bentonite pellets was added The well was then sealed with Portland cement to the surface A 2" <br /> x 24" long PVC stove pipe was placed over the top of the 314" pipe at the surface and cemented <br /> into place The stove pipe allows a 2" diameter, water-tight well plug and lock to be placed <br /> over the well A 7-inch diameter, water-tight, well cover was installed over the top of the well <br /> • A copy of the boring log and well schematic is attached in Appendix B <br /> Surveying <br /> A licensed land surveyor was retained to survey monitoring well MW-12 to determine the <br /> elevation of the well casing The survey included both location and elevation determinations <br /> Elevation readings were measured to the nearest 0 01 foot and corrected to mean sea level <br /> CCI retained a professional surveyor (Jim Rasp, P E) to survey the location of all 13 site wells <br /> using Global Positioning Satellite (GPS) The wells were surveyed to within one meter accuracy <br /> at 11 00 am on October 6, 2001 using a Leica GS-50, s/n 50202 The GPS unit is a sub-meter <br /> accuracy unit approved by the State of California Copies of the well survey data are attached in <br /> Appendix C <br /> Groundwater Sampling <br /> On October 4, 2001, CCI sampled twelve of the thirteen wells for the quarterly sample round As <br /> previously mentioned, monitoring well MW-8 was found to be dry Prior to groundwater <br /> sampling, CCI measured the depth to groundwater using an electronic sounding tape and field- <br /> checked the wells for the presence of free-floating product by collecting a sample in a clear <br /> acrylic bailer Free-floating product was not observed Moderate product odor was noted <br /> • <br />
